The Triplane was briefly succesful with a couple of British and French naval fighter squadrons early in 1917, but had structural and maintenance issues, and was armed with one machine gun only. The Fokker Dr.I was developed in response.

The prototype Triplane first flew in May 1916 and the type entered service with the Royal Naval Air Service early in 1917 and a total of 147 were built. It was a very agile but lightly armed type that was soon superceded by the biplanes. Often quoted as cn 8385M, but that is its allocated RAF maintenance serial.
